Originally from West Africa, Emília do Patrocínio arrived enslaved in Brazil in the 1820s and bought her freedom in 1839 after having prospered by selling foodstuffs. She became part of an African elite that thrived in cities like Rio de Janeiro, Salvador, Recife and São Luís. In the early 1850s, already the widow of Bernardo José Soares, an African man who owned poultry and vegetable stalls in the Candelária market, Emília became a well-known member of the Fraternity of Saint Elesbaan and Saint Ephigenia and a “judge of devotion” of Nossa Senhora dos Remédios (Our Lady of Los Remedios). Her retail business continued to grow up to the 1880s as she accumulated grocery stores, real estate, jewelry and captives. Between 1850 and 1870, Emília freed at least ten enslaved people.

Kerolayne Kemblin: Bridging Tradition and Innovation in Amazonian Art

Kerolayne Kemblin, born in Manaus, Brazil, represents a vibrant voice within contemporary Brazilian art, particularly focusing on the rich cultural heritage of the Amazon rainforest. Her artistic journey blends influences from indigenous traditions with experimental techniques like collage, graffiti, lambe-lambes, and digital image manipulation—a deliberate fusion that speaks to her deep connection with the region’s identity and its urgent need for preservation.
  • Education: Kemblin holds a degree in Visual Arts from Universidade Federal Amazônica (UFAM), providing her with a foundational understanding of artistic principles alongside an appreciation for Amazonian ecological concerns.
  • Technique & Style: Her distinctive style is characterized by layering textures and imagery—often incorporating plant fragments—onto digital canvases. This approach reflects her engagement with umbanda spirituality and AfroDiasporic traditions, exploring themes of memory, resilience, and interconnectedness.
  • Exhibitions & Recognition: Kemblin’s work has garnered attention through participation in notable events such as ‘Enciclopédia Negra,’ a project dedicated to showcasing Black artists and their contributions to Brazilian culture, and ‘Arte Fora do Museu,’ furthering her commitment to promoting artistic expression beyond conventional institutional spaces.

Exploring Amazonian Identity Through Collage & Graffiti

Kemblin’s artistic process isn't merely about creating visually stimulating pieces; it’s a deliberate act of storytelling. She utilizes collage techniques—assembling fragments of photographs, botanical specimens, and handwritten text—to construct narratives that grapple with issues of environmental degradation and cultural preservation. Simultaneously, she employs graffiti art as a medium for social commentary, injecting vibrant color and rebellious energy into urban landscapes to amplify voices often marginalized within mainstream discourse.
  • Symbolism: Recurring motifs in her artwork – particularly plant imagery – symbolize the Amazon’s biodiversity and serve as reminders of its vulnerability.
  • Social Commentary: Kemblin's graffiti interventions aim to provoke dialogue about social justice, indigenous rights, and the importance of confronting systemic inequalities.

Influences & Artistic Legacy

Kemblin’s artistic vision draws inspiration from a confluence of sources—including Amazonian folklore, AfroDiasporic aesthetics, and the broader movement for social activism. Her work aligns with the ethos of ‘Arte Fora do Museu,’ prioritizing accessibility and fostering engagement with art beyond the confines of traditional galleries. She embodies a commitment to honoring cultural heritage while embracing innovation as a tool for shaping a more equitable future—a powerful testament to the transformative potential of artistic expression.
